Harmonic Balancer - Crankshaft Pulley: Service and Repair
Vibration Damper
Special tools, testers and auxiliary items required
• 3 Jaw Puller
• Crankshaft Insert (9020)
• Forcing Screw (C-4685-C1)
• Sprocket Installer (9792)
Removing
- Disconnect the negative battery cable.
- Raise and suitably support the vehicle.
- Remove the right front wheel and tire.
- Remove the accessory drive belt. Refer to => [ Accessory Drive Belt ] Accessory Drive Belt.
- Remove the vibration damper bolt.
- Using a 3 jaw puller (1) , and crankshaft insert (9020) (2), remove the vibration damper from the crankshaft.
Installing
- Using the forcing screw (C-4685-C1) (5.9 in.) (2), with the nut and thrust bearing from the sprocket installer (6792) and installer (6792-1) (1), install the vibration damper.
- Install the vibration damper bolt. Tighten the bolt to 95 Nm (70 ft lbs).
- Install the accessory drive belt. Refer to => [ Accessory Drive Belt ] Accessory Drive Belt.
- Install the right front wheel and tire.
- Lower the vehicle.
- Connect the negative battery cable.
